March 11th marks the release of the film Red Riding Hood which looks like a fun, dark ride. Buried in the film is Kusarigama soldier, Paul Wu who has had so many acting roles in films and TV, like The Art of War, Blade and The Mummy that it is impossible to list and we certainly want to talk to him about whether or not he plans to focus more on featured acting roles in the future over his main claim to fame, stunt work. But talking about both is something we will definately do when he is in L.A. next month.

Here is the thing about stunt work in Hollywood…it is REALLY important, it is an amazing part of acting that is often overlooked, and it is hard work! Paul Wu’s career doing stunts ranks him as a superstar having worked on blockbuster films like Romeo Must Die, Bulletproof Monk, X2, The Last Samuari, The Chronicles of Riddick, I, Robot, Underworld: Evolution, X-Men: the Last Stand, Snakes On a Plane, Rise of the Silver Surfer, War (Jet Li & Jason Staham), Journey to the Center of the Earth, Jumper, The Mummy: Tomb of the Dragon Emerpor, The Day the Earth Stood Still, Watchmen; Night At the Museum: Battle of the Smithsonian, Repo Man, and the upcoming film Sucker Punch.
